博物馆作为人类文明的宝库,承载着丰富的历史和文化信息。随着科技的不断发展,博物馆导览系统也在经历着革新。本文将深入探讨多模态交互导览系统的设计理念、技术实现以及其对博物馆参观体验的革新影响。
一、多模态交互导览系统的概念
多模态交互导览系统是指结合多种交互方式,如语音、图像、触控等,为参观者提供更加丰富、便捷的导览服务。这种系统不仅能够提供传统的文字和图像信息,还能通过多种感官方式增强参观体验。
二、多模态交互导览系统的设计理念
1. 用户体验至上
设计多模态交互导览系统时,首要考虑的是用户体验。系统应易于上手,操作简便,能够满足不同年龄、文化背景的参观者需求。
2. 信息丰富性与准确性
系统应提供全面、准确的历史和文化信息,同时兼顾信息的深度和广度,满足不同层次参观者的需求。
3. 技术创新与应用
多模态交互导览系统应充分利用现代科技,如人工智能、虚拟现实、增强现实等,为参观者带来全新的体验。
三、多模态交互导览系统的技术实现
1. 语音交互
语音交互是多模态交互导览系统的重要组成部分。通过语音识别和语音合成技术,系统可以实现对参观者语音指令的识别和响应。
import speech_recognition as sr
# 初始化语音识别器
recognizer = sr.Recognizer()
# 语音识别
with sr.Microphone() as source:
audio = recognizer.listen(source)
try:
# 使用Google语音识别
text = recognizer.recognize_google(audio)
print("您说的内容是:", text)
except sr.UnknownValueError:
print("无法理解您说的话")
except sr.RequestError:
print("请求失败,请稍后再试")
2. 图像识别
图像识别技术可以帮助参观者通过拍摄图片获取相关信息。系统可以识别图片中的物体、场景,并返回相应的历史和文化背景。
import cv2
# 加载图片
image = cv2.imread('example.jpg')
# 图像识别(此处以人脸识别为例)
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')
faces = face_cascade.detectMultiScale(image, scaleFactor=1.1, minNeighbors=5)
for (x, y, w, h) in faces:
print("检测到人脸:", x, y, w, h)
3. 触控交互
触控交互为参观者提供了直观的操作方式。通过触摸屏幕,参观者可以浏览信息、切换展示内容等。
四、多模态交互导览系统的革新影响
1. 提升参观体验
多模态交互导览系统为参观者提供了更加丰富、便捷的导览服务,有效提升了参观体验。
2. 优化博物馆运营
系统可以帮助博物馆更好地管理参观者,提高运营效率。
3. 促进文化传播
多模态交互导览系统有助于传播博物馆所承载的历史和文化信息,让更多人了解和热爱自己的文化。
总之,多模态交互导览系统的设计革新为博物馆带来了前所未有的发展机遇。随着技术的不断进步,相信未来博物馆导览系统将更加智能化、个性化,为参观者带来更加美好的体验。
